...A SEVERE THUNDERSTORM W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 915 AM CST
FOR SOUTHEASTERN LEWIS...LAWRENCE...MAURY AND WESTERN GILES
COUNTIES...

At 901 AM CST, severe thunderstorms were located along a line
extending from near Mount Pleasant to near Summertown to 8 miles
northeast of Lawrenceburg to near Loretto, moving northeast at 60
mph.

HAZARD...70 mph wind gusts.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Expect considerable tree damage. Damage is likely to mobile
         homes, roofs, and outbuildings.

Locations impacted include...
Columbia, Lawrenceburg, Pulaski, Spring Hill, Mount Pleasant,
Loretto, Summertown, St. Joseph, Minor Hill, Ethridge, Lynnville,
Henryville, Culleoka, I-65 East Of Columbia, Goodspring, Leoma and
Hampshire.

This includes Interstate 65 between mile markers 38 and 47.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

A Tornado Watch remains in effect until 100 PM CST for Middle
Tennessee.

For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.
